About Preface Health
Preface Health is building AI referral infrastructure for healthcare, helping patients get from a primary or urgent care visit to the right specialist quickly and seamlessly. The platform is deployed across 75+ urgent care locations and is piloting with a top-three U.S. health system, with deep EMR integration work underpinning the product. A team of three moving fast in a market that has long lacked a coordinated referral layer.

The Role
Preface Health's first engineer — a full-stack founding hire who owns the entire technical surface alongside the technical co-founder, building and shipping across front end, back end, and cloud while contributing to product thinking as the company scales its urgent-care and health-system network.
What You'll Be Doing
- Own the full technical stack — front end, back end, and cloud infrastructure — building and shipping across all layers.
- Design and ship EMR integrations connecting the referral platform to urgent care, ER, and specialist workflows.
- Build and iterate on the core referral flow so patients get routed to the right specialist quickly and reliably.
- Contribute to product decisions alongside the co-founders, translating clinical and operational needs into engineering priorities.
- Establish engineering foundations, patterns, and practices as the first engineering hire.
Tech stack: Python backend, front end, cloud infrastructure; EMR integrations / healthcare data standards.
